Question please: how can I improve the graphics (smooth pixels) of NES Games in Retroarch with Nestopia core? what settings can I select? I am looking for a simple way to smooth the pixels, make them look a bit better on modern TV.
If you go into the Retroarch settings and then go to Video/Scaling, there is a Bilinear Filtering option you can toggle on. See how you like that.
